The only city I know, which has such small trams, is Duisburg. Their "GT 10 NC-DU" trams are 2,20m wide too. And especially designed for Duisburg; apparently such narrow trams aren't available "off-the-shelf".

Kaliningrad tramlines

Last summer, I rode by bicycle from Berlin to Kaliningrad and then back to France.The state of this interesting tram network dating from the german
period is not flourishing.On the main streets, new tracks were laid,but on
many other streets and also when the tracks are separated from the uncontrolled car trafic, tram tracks are in bad condition.Trams are dangerously " pitching" so that they have to go slowly.Only single cars are running and on many lines, even when the tracks have been renewed, there
is no tram trafic at all (especially on the north-south line behind the cathedral and Kant's grave and along the new and beautiful district on the
Staraya Pregolya bank; it also the case along the restored Königstor where
new tracks were dismantled).At all tram stations, even on streets which are
as large as motorways, ther are no islands for the security of travellers:they
have to cross all traffic lanes to get in or out the tam...Using bicycle as a daily means of transport is also not easy in Kaliningrad:
security problems when you must leave your bicycle in the street;main streets which are as large as motorways; many other streets which are in bad condition, so that it is easier to ride on the pavement...
To improve living environmental conditions in this attractive metropolitan area,
I hope that cycling as well as other sustainable modes of transport such as
tramcars will be facilitated and developped.
